Dancing On Ice, which aired on Sunday night. In particular, Holly Willoughby’s unashamedly princess-y glam dress and make-up to match.
While many make-up artists and hairdressers are not currently able to work, there is an exception for TV and film production.
Willoughby had her hairdresser and her make-up artist Patsy O'Neill backstage. Speaking to the Telegraph about Sunday night’s look, O’Neill says, “I always design the make-up look for Dancing On Ice in the days before the filming, based on the dress I know she’ll be wearing.
